Man Pretends to be a Lawncare Worker to Evade Law Enforcement

NEWS RELEASE

 

Date/Time of Offense: Wednesday, September 20, 2023.

 

Charge(s)/Offense(s): Felony Breaking and Entering

   Felony Possession of Burglary Tools 

   Four Counts of Misdemeanor Larceny

   Misdemeanor Damage to Property 

   Misdemeanor Resist, Obstruct, and Delay of an Officer 

   Misdemeanor Driving While License Revoked 

 

Location: Multiple residences on Tucker Road in Statesville

 

Suspect: Timothy Lee Rankin, 56 Years Old

Sheriff Darren Campbell stated: On Wednesday, September 20, 2023, Iredell County Sheriff’s Office Deputies were dispatched to the area of Tuckers Road in Statesville, in reference to a suspicious person. Sergeant D. Stutts, Lieutenant D. Christian, and Deputy D. Frye responded to the area and were able to locate the suspicious person. When Deputies began to question the man, Timothy Lee Rankin, he stated he was there to do yardwork for the homeowner and attempted to crank a push mower to impersonate a lawn care worker. The homeowner was then questioned about this and she indicated that she did not know the man nor did she have someone doing the yardwork for her.

 

The suspect then attempted to flee on foot but was quickly apprehended by deputies. Upon further questioning the suspect admitted to taking the vehicle earlier the same morning from an additional victim. Inside of this vehicle were various stolen items including power tools, an air compressor, chainsaws, a generator, and gas cans. 

 

Multiple victims on Tucker Road started calling into ECOM reporting that a suspect matching the same description had been on their property and had stolen various items.

 

Detective J. Graves and Detective K. Campbell arrived on the scene to canvass the area and continue the investigation. They spoke with neighbors and witnesses and were able to determine where the stolen property came from. 

 

Deputy Frye arrested and transported Rankin to the Iredell County Detention Center where he was brought before Magistrate Watkins who issued a 26,000.00 dollar secured bond. 

 

The case is ongoing and more charges are forthcoming.
